About Charles Martinez

Charles Martinez is a scholar working on Hematology, Radiology, Nuclear Medicine and Imaging, Health Information Management, Pulmonary and Respiratory Medicine and Oncology, having authored 11 papers that have together received 141 indexed citations. Recurring topics across this work include Hematopoietic Stem Cell Transplantation (5 papers), Cancer Genomics and Diagnostics (2 papers), Multiple Myeloma Research and Treatments (2 papers), Electronic Health Records Systems (2 papers), Cytomegalovirus and herpesvirus research (1 paper), Amyloidosis: Diagnosis, Treatment, Outcomes (1 paper), Renal and Vascular Pathologies (1 paper) and Cardiovascular Function and Risk Factors (1 paper). The work is most often cited by research in Hematology (85 citations), Oncology (67 citations), Transplantation (4 citations), Genetics (14 citations) and Immunology (26 citations). Charles Martinez has collaborated with scholars based in United States, Czechia and Spain. Frequent co-authors include Roy B. Jones, Elizabeth J. Shpall, James R. Murphy, Emili Montserrat, Wilbur A. Franklin, Joan Bladé, Enric Carreras, John A. Glaspy, Jordi Esteve and Susana Rives. Their work appears in journals such as Biology of Blood and Marrow Transplantation, Blood, Bone Marrow Transplantation, Transplantation and Cellular Therapy and Current Oncology Reports.
